Distributed Ledger Technology or Blockchain, as its popularly known, can help support a number of business functions when applied in the right manner. Grumnech is leading the way by designing applications and workflows to solve business problems using Blockchain. Contracts and Legal One of the most salient features of Blockchain are its immutability. This makes it a perfect tech candidate to apply to business processes in the Contracts/Legal space. Audit Services Workflows that allow business functions to record actions on a blockchain make it easier for auditors to verify. Not only does it make the process more time efficient, it also saves significant costs. Document Management An easy to use and practical repository can save teams and organisations thousands of hours in lost productivity. Use our solution to enhance document management for your critical record keeping needs.
